History of C


             www.eshikshak.co.in



www.eshikshak.co.in
‘C’ Language
● It is most popular language because
  ○ Structured Programming Language
  ○ High Level Language
  ○ Machine Independent Language or Portable
    or Platform Independent




              www.eshikshak.co.in
History
● History of C and UNIX operating system
  are intertwined
● Seeds of UNIX system began in 1965, at
  MIT after the completion of project called
  Project MAC
● MAC – It is was first time-sharing
  computer systems
● MAC as joint with Bell Labs, began a
  project called MULTICS (Multiplexed Information and
  Computing Servies)   www.eshikshak.co.in
Continue - History
● IBM had not yet built time-sharing into
  their computers.
● Trio MIT, General Electric & Bell Labs
  worked for a few years in 1969
● Bell Labs decided to discontinue the
  project
● Ken Thompson and Dennis Ritchie smart
  programmer were frustrated

              www.eshikshak.co.in
Continue - History
● They continue with project with an intense
  “To develop a product that would simplfy
  the dialog between human and machine.”
  Thus named the project as UNIX
● PDP-7 machine was not eligible to start a
  implementation of UNIX
● B language was used to develop the
  UNIX system on GE -635 machine

               www.eshikshak.co.in
Continue - History
● Insufficient features of B Language
● B and BPCL Languages are typeless
● In 1971, Dennis Ritche decided to
  improve B and BCPL
● He called it as NB “New B”, by adding
  data type features
● Enhancement worked continue and
  Dennis Ritchie graced it with a name ‘C’

               www.eshikshak.co.in
Continue - History
● UNIX Kernel was developed using ‘C’
  Language
● It was provided to universities
● In 1980 it was most popular language and
  its compiler were available for all the
  platforms and machines
● American National Standard Institute
  define ‘C’ Language
● In year 1989 ANSI C was released
              www.eshikshak.co.in
C History
● Developed between 1969 and 1973 along
  with Unix
● Dennis Ritchie – Father of ‘C’
● Designed for systems programming
  ○ Operating systems
  ○ Utility programs
  ○ Compilers
  ○ Filters
● Evolved from B, which evolved from
  BCPL        www.eshikshak.co.in
